- The Pageant of Peace and the National Christmas Tree The Pageant of Peace is a ceremony held each year in early December to light the National Christmas Tree. - Forget the Vacation - Take a Staycation! Staycation is a portmanteau that combines "stay" and "vacation" and refers to a holiday that takes place either at or near home.
